Output 66c16ce96b8f7868eaf1c7e0e80233b73fa75a0600fe17b2a8a1aecd8ebc45da:2

value
1327161
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 a58c83f6ac34675ed893a9822269e68d35768556 OP_EQUALVERIFY OP_CHECKSIG
address
1G6Lpqf7XmhNM9KCQZoTTvr2Zet9BdcXAP
transaction
66c16ce96b8f7868eaf1c7e0e80233b73fa75a0600fe17b2a8a1aecd8ebc45da
spent
true